E3-HCR is a highly chemical resistant, three-component novolac epoxy grout designed for use in aggressive industrial environments. It withstands concentrated acids, alkalis, and solvents while delivering ultra-high compressive strength, very low creep, and excellent Effective Bearing Area (EBA). With Euclid’s patented DL Technology™ aggregate, E3-HCR minimizes dust during mixing and handling while providing outstanding vibration dampening and long-term durability.
Compressive Strength (ASTM C579) | 15,000 psi (1 day); 19,500 psi (28 days); 20,000 psi post-cure |
Flexural Strength (ASTM C580) | 5,400 psi (1 day); 5,800 psi (28 days) |
Tensile Strength (ASTM C307) | 2,400 psi (1 day); 2,550 psi (28 days) |
Bond Strength (ASTM C882) | 3,200 psi (7 days); 3,350 psi (28 days) |
Effective Bearing Area | Greater than 95% |
Working Time | Approx. 34 minutes at 73°F (23°C) |
Chemical Resistance | Excellent resistance to concentrated acids, alkalis, solvents, fuels, and industrial chemicals |
Packaging | 1.43 CF kit (resin, hardener, aggregate) |
What makes E3-HCR different from other epoxy grouts?
It combines novolac epoxy chemistry with DL Technology™ aggregate, giving it superior chemical resistance and reduced dust during mixing.
Can it handle concentrated acids and alkalis?
Yes. E3-HCR is formulated for aggressive chemical environments, resisting concentrated acids, alkalis, and solvents.
What is the Effective Bearing Area (EBA)?
Greater than 95%, ensuring stable support under heavy loads.
How long is the working time?
Approximately 34 minutes at 73°F, depending on conditions.
How should tools be cleaned?
Tools and mixers can be cleaned with soap and water immediately after use.
